Company Overview

Hatch is a globally recognised engineering and consulting firm with over 70 years of experience across mining, energy, and infrastructure sectors. With a presence in more than 150 countries, Hatch focuses on delivering innovative, safe, and sustainable engineering solutions.

The company is known for combining global expertise with local insight, helping clients solve complex challenges while contributing to a better and more sustainable world.
